Glenwood and John Edmondson High Schools

St Hilliers, as part of the Axiom Education Consortium, were contracted to provide the Department with construction and project management services for the New Schools Privately Financed Project.

The project, the first PPP social infrastructure development in NSW ... has a value of approximately AUD $135 million. St Hilliers was responsible for building the two secondary schools within the project.

As a landmark project in NSW, the outcome has been the subject of close scrutiny and high sensistivity for the Department. St Hilliers contribution has played a major part in the project's acknowledged success.

... St Hilliers representatives have consistently demonstrated a high degree of professionalism in their dealings with the Department. They have proven themselves to be flexible in their approach to problems, high communicative and enthusiastically committed to the PPP process."

Peter Ross, Project Director (PPP), NSW Department of Education and Training
